The original plan was to recon the recently (re) opened Joe Bay using North Nest Key as a base camp.
However due to tropical storm Gordon arriving a day early, the trip had to be cut short.

.

The idea behind this trip was to check out the

  Joe Bay area in northeastern Florida Bay.

Due to time constraints, it took place over the Labor Day weekend just ahead of approaching tropical storm Gordon. The plan me and Kayak Ted (aka Spiritwalker) made was to camp at North Nest Key and use it as a base camp for two nights. Joe Bay is intriguing because it has been re-opened to the public after being closed off for almost 40 years. It is also prime habitat for the American Crocodile, of which we had hoped to see many. Other than the “wow” factor of seeing many salties, we thought it’d be neat to go paddling where almost no one has been in decades and catch up with the Nest Keys post Hurricane Irma!

To access eastern Florida Bay, one of the best locations to launch from is Key Largo’s very own Florida Bay Outfitters (FBO) at the north end of the Keys. It’s a natural choice for paddling Blackwater Sound, Barnes Sound, Buttonwood Sound and to the Nest Keys. But just like anywhere in the Keys, parking space is very limited. The other nice thing about launching from FBO is that they are a rental outfitter and a fully stocked retail kayak and paddleboard shop. In case you forget or need paddling related products like charts, books, clothing, skirts, paddles, etc .. they probably have it. This is in stark contrast to launching say from Flamingo or even Everglades City, where you’ll have a difficult time getting anything more than basic consumable supplies!

The shop is under new ownership, so you should call ahead

to make arrangements with them!

Incidentally, right next door to FBO is the Caribbean Club, the location used in the filming of the 1948 classic Humphrey Bogart and Lauren Bacall film ‘Key Largo‘. The property also has the distinction of being the very last project of Carl Fisher – the man who developed Miami Beach!

Paddling out to the Nest Keys is straightforward and about nine miles from FBO. You can paddle up through either “The Boggies” or Dusenbury Creek. Actually it’s common to make a loop and use both. There are a couple of things to keep in mind however. One is that on a good easterly or southeasterly wind, both Blackwater Sound and Florida Bay can carry a good fetch and bring 3 – 4′ up to 6 foot waves. Be sure to have a good sprayskirt as those quartering seas will break on deck frequently. I initially started with my old nylon skirt instead of my nice fitting neoprene one and ended up with a bunch of water in the cockpit!

The other thing to watch out for is motor boaters and jetskiers of

which there will be many, especially on weekends!

North Nest Key is one of only two islands in Florida Bay currently open for backcountry camping. The other is Little Rabbit Key in the center of the ‘Bay which has a very nice remote feel. Although Nest Key is a part of Everglades National Park, it is just the opposite of remote due to it’s close proximity to Key Largo. It didn’t help that it was Labor Day weekend! Consequently this island had the feel of a boater’s sandbar party, complete with jetskis, loud stereos, folks drinking and barbecuing, etc. When we arrived, there were probably twice as many boats as shown, and we had to carefully weave our way between vessels to make our landing on the key. There was no law enforcement presence, but maybe they had already left for the day. Regardless, it’s not always this busy, but there are usually boaters around because this is Key Largo’s backyard!

North Nest Key is not the place to go if you seek solitude,

however it’s worth a visit and makes a great base camp location

for exploring eastern Florida Bay.

Near dusk all the boaters departed and the island was nice and quiet.

Thanks to the easterly breezes, there were almost no bugs at all and it was a very pleasant evening. One nice thing to note about out here in eastern Florida Bay is that the tidal range is pretty small, maybe a foot or even less typically. This makes it possible to camp on those narrow strips of beach on north Nest Key! It’s in contrast to central and western parts of the ‘Bay where 3 to 4 foot tidal swings are not uncommon.

The evening and most of the night were pleasant camping, but  by dawn it was clear that things had changed. Getting up with the sunrise, there was a lot of cloud cover and a heavy damp feeling in the air. Listening to the weather radio and checking radar on the phone we could see that tropical storm Gordon had arrived into our area earlier than anticipated. By 8:30, we were already seeing lightning strikes to the NE in the distance which was definitely not a good sign! We had to make a decision, and both agreed that in light of our situation we’d bag it and head back a day early. We packed up camp just in time before all the heavy rain hit.

Rounding the eastern tip of North Nest Key is a long catwalk to where two porta potties used to be before Hurricane Irma. Although the island itself fared well during the hurricane, this only man-made structure on the key did not! The ramp is still twisted from the hurricane and one of the toilets is gone. The other is now out in the open, i.e. “En plein air” shall we say. This was a year after Irma!

Navigating back towards Dusenbury Creek was easy once the rain cleared up some. Just look on the horizon for the big concrete microwave communications relay tower in Key Largo. It’s right across from the entrance into John Pennekamp Coral Reef State Park, and is an excellent landmark. Of course you still need to know the layout of the area, so a chart is always good to have! However paddling in the general direction of the tower will get you to the entrance to the creek.

Note that Dusenbury Creek itself is a full speed boating zone

and a part of the Intracoastal Waterway (ICW).

The creek narrows considerably and some of the boat wakes from arrogant idiot boaters get large enough to swamp an unprepared paddler. The only good thing is the since it’s bordered by mangroves, the waves dissipate very quickly. There are also some really tight side creeks where powerboats can’t go that are worth exploring!
